The Utah Jazz appear determined to retain restricted free agent Gordon Hayward, but a multitude of fellow NBA teams are looking to sign the two-way forward, one of which presumably includes the Boston Celtics. That’s the word from Utah Jazz beat writer Jody Genessy who says the Celtics have contacted Hayward.

The presumed Boston Celtics interest in Gordon Hayward isn’t exactly new as they’ve been rumored to have had interest for quite some time, though rumors of such began to re-surface earlier this week as the NBA’s free agent period was set to open.

As things stand currently, the Celtics do have cap space to make Hayward an offer and enough to make it so the Utah Jazz at least have to question if matching an offer sheet is worth it. They’ve repeatedly suggested they have every intention to do so, but at what point does Hayward become too expensive for what he does? That’s a decision the Utah Jazz front office is going to need to make as it’s all but inevitable that Hayward will receive an offer sheet at some point, be it from the Celtics or another interested team. That of course is assuming he and the Jazz don’t come to an agreement on their own contract.

It’s not known if the Celtics plan to present Gordon Hayward with an offer sheet at this time as they’ve only contacted him, not presented him with any type of official offer.

The Jazz and other NBA franchises are said to be contacting Hayward in the very near future.
